4人の営業担当者(古田 哲也、高橋 真紀、松沢 彩子、森上 偉久馬)から示される3つの製品(アメリカンクラッカー、アメリカンポーク、インドカレーパン)の最高単価を表示するとします。それには、値フィルタを使用して、データベースの Salesperson フィールドと Product Name フィールドを取り出す必要があります。
次の図は、4人の営業担当者から示される3つの製品の最高単価を表示する FlexPivotGrid です。
FlexPivotGrid コントロールで値フィルタ処理を実装するには、次の手順を実行します。この実装は、「コードによるデータソースへの FlexPivot の連結」トピックで作成したサンプルを使用します。
- [行]リストに Salesperson フィールドと ProductName フィールド、[値]リストに UnitPrice フィールドを追加します。
- [行]リストの[Salesperson]フィールドを右クリックし、[フィールドの設定]オプションを1回クリックして[フィールドの設定]ダイアログを開きます。
- 示されたリストから次の営業担当者を選択します。
- [行]リストの[ProductName]フィールドを右クリックし、[フィールドの設定]オプションを1回クリックして[フィールドの設定]ダイアログを開きます。
- 示されたリストから次の製品を選択します。
- アメリカンクラッカー
- アメリカンポーク
- インドカレーパン
- [値]リストの[UnitPrice]フィールドを右クリックし、[フィールドの設定]オプションを1回クリックして[フィールドの設定]ダイアログを開きます。
- [小計]タブに移動し、[最大]を選択します。